Grout plant for tunnel lining

This integrated grouting plant is specifically designed for shield/TBM tunnel segment lining. It combines a high-speed grouting tank, a grout storage and mixing tank, and a high-pressure grouting pump into one unit. During tunnel excavation, it prepares cement/bentonite grout to fill the annular gap (annular gap) between the lining segments and the surrounding rock.

Today, our factory shipped a grout plant equipped with a flow meter. It’s a compact, integrated grouting unit that combines mixing, storage, and pumping into one system, capable of stably delivering grout under controlled pressure. The customer primarily uses it for tunnel lining grouting projects. The main materials are cement grout, bentonite, or high-density grout, depending on geological conditions. The grouting strategy (simultaneous grouting or secondary grouting) depends on the construction method (tunnel boring machine or drill-and-blast method).

The compact grout plant consists of the following components:
1. High-shear colloidal mixer: High-shear vortex mixing quickly blends cement, bentonite, and water into a homogeneous, segregation-free grout (300L);
2. Agitator tank: Continuously agitates and stores the grout at low speed to prevent sedimentation and stratification, ensuring continuous grouting (300L volume);
3. Hydraulic grout pump: Adjustable pressure and displacement pump delivers grout to the segment injection holes under high pressure, adjustable from 0 to 10 MPa.

Core applications in tunnel construction:
1. Segment backfill grouting (primary application): Immediately after the concrete segments are assembled by the tunnel boring machine (TBM), grout is injected into the annular gaps on the outer side of the segments to fill voids, fix the lining, evenly transfer ground pressure, and control surface settlement;
2. Water plugging and seepage prevention: Seals seepage in the surrounding rock to prevent groundwater from seeping into the tunnel;
3. Ground reinforcement: Fills and consolidates soil in weak surrounding rock areas to improve the overall stability of the tunnel.

This grout plant features an integrated skid-mounted structure, compact size, and can move within the tunnel with the TBM trolley. We offer both electric and diesel drive options, and the hydraulic pump pressure and flow are infinitely adjustable for continuous grout supply, making it suitable for TBM synchronous uninterrupted grouting construction.
